随着区块链技术的发展,以太坊作为一个智能合约平台,越来越受到用户的广泛关注。在以太坊生态中,发币(Token Generation)成为了一项重要功能,而如何安全有效地发币则成为了许多用户面临的挑战。使用硬件钱包进行发币,可以为用户提供一个安全和便利的途径。本文将详细介绍如何利用以太坊硬件钱包安全地发币,以及相关的优势和潜在问题的解答。
一、以太坊硬件钱包简介
以太坊硬件钱包是一种专为存储和管理以太坊与其代币而设计的物理设备。与软件钱包相比,硬件钱包提供了更高的安全级别,因其将私钥存储在离线环境中,有效防止黑客入侵和恶意软件攻击。市场上流行的硬件钱包如Ledger Nano S、Trezor等,都具备支持以太坊及其代币的功能。
二、发币的基本概念
发币,俗称代币发行,指的是通过区块链技术创造新的代币,并将这些代币分发给用户或投资者。以太坊的智能合约功能使得这一过程变得简单而高效。通过编写符合ERC-20或ERC-721标准的智能合约,开发者可以在以太坊网络上创建自己的代币。
三、为何选择硬件钱包进行发币
使用硬件钱包进行发币,具有以下几点优势:
- 安全性高:硬件钱包将私钥存储在设备内部,不联网,极大减少了被网络攻击的风险。
- 操作便利:大多数硬件钱包都提供了用户友好的接口,便于用户进行代币管理和交易。
- 多种加密资产支持:许多硬件钱包支持多种加密货币,这意味着用户可以在一个设备上管理不同的资产。
- 防篡改保护:硬件钱包通常会有物理防篡改措施,确保设备的安全性。
四、如何使用以太坊硬件钱包发币
发币的步骤主要包括以下几个方面:
1. 准备硬件钱包
首先,用户需要准备一个支持以太坊的硬件钱包,如Ledger或Trezor。遵循官方说明书进行设备的初始设置,确保钱包的安全性,例如设置强密码和备份恢复短语等。
2. 下载并安装相关软件
很多硬件钱包都需要配套的桌面应用或扩展程序,例如Ledger Live或Trezor Suite。用户需要下载并安装这些软件,以便于管理以太坊及其代币。
3. 创建智能合约
用户可以通过Solidity等编程语言编写智能合约,定义代币的特性,例如总供应量、名称、符号等。可以参考开源代码进行修改,确保合约符合ERC-20标准。
4. 部署智能合约
利用硬件钱包与以太坊网络连接,通过部署智能合约来创造新代币。在这一过程中,用户需要向以太坊网络支付一定的交易费用(Gas Fee)。确保在连接硬件钱包时,遵循严格的安全措施,以保护私钥。
5. 发送代币到其他地址
一旦代币创建成功,用户可以将代币分发到其他以太坊地址。在操作时,仍需保持警惕,确保发送的地址正确,并查看交易费用。
五、发币注意事项
虽然发币过程看似简单,但以下几个注意事项却至关重要:
- 代码审查:发布智能合约前,确保代码经过彻底审查,以避免出现漏洞和安全问题。
- 合规性在某些国家和地区,发币可能涉及法律风险,应优先考虑合法合规。
- 用户教育:如果计划公开发币,确保用户了解如何安全地管理自己的资产,避免钓鱼欺诈等问题。
六、可能相关问题
1. 硬件钱包真的安全可靠吗?
硬件钱包因其独特的设计,提供了比软件钱包更高的安全性。私钥离线存储,极大地降低了攻击风险。然而,用户仍需保障设备的物理安全,避免被恶意软件或物理盗窃。这意味着,虽然硬件钱包大幅提高了资产安全性,但用户在使用时仍需采取适当的安全措施。
2. 如何选择合适的硬件钱包?
选择适合的硬件钱包时,用户应考虑以下因素:支持的加密货币种类,用户界面友好性,安全性能(如PIN码、备份恢复短语),品牌声誉和价格等。目前比较热门的有Ledger和Trezor,这两者都在市场上得到了充分的验证。
3. 发币的法律风险有哪些?
在进行发币之前,了解相关的法律法规是非常重要的。不同国家对加密货币的监管政策不同。在某些地区,发币可能被视为证券发行,因此可能需要遵循更多的法律法规。建议咨询法律专业人士,确保所采取的行动符合当地法律。
总结来说,利用以太坊硬件钱包发币为用户提供了一种安全和高效的方法来管理他们的加密资产。虽然发币背后有许多挑战和潜在的问题,但只要遵循适当的步骤并保持高警惕,用户便能够在这一领域中游刃有余,让数字资产真正发挥其价值。